Naples, Giovanni Francesco Paci, 1726. In 4°. On the frontispiece, a full-page copper-engraved portrait of the author, a frontispiece printed in red and black, an illustrated initial, and other ornamentation, a large copper-engraved and folded geographical map entitled Campaniae Antiquae Descriptio , 320 x 380 mm., scattered browning, a small tear in the upper margin of the plate without loss of the engraved part, a contemporary full parchment binding, a brown tag on the smooth spine.
The lot also includes the translation of the work into the vernacular by Girolamo Aquino Capuano , La Campania di F.Antonio Sanfelice , Naples, V. Orsini, 1796. In 8°. Portrait of the author on the frontispiece and a folded plate, widespread browning.

Specialist Notes
Work published by Antonio Sanfelice senior (1515-1570), and not by his great-nephew Antonio Sanfelice, bishop of Nardò. It was, however, published by the latter's younger brother, Ferdinando Sanfelice (1675-1748), a famous architect. The first edition was published in Latin in 1562 ( De Origine et situ Campaniae ).
